webpack本身就是为了打包js所设计,作为第一节,介绍怎么打包js。1.检验webpack规范支持webpack支持es6,CommonJS,AMD。创建vendor文件夹,其中minus.js、multi.js和sum.js分别用Co…
在配置webpack4报错:Error:Chunk.entrypoints:UseChunks.groupsIterableandfilterbyinstanceofEntrypointinstead时,应该是插extract-text-w…
cnpmiwebpck@4webpack-cli-Dcnpmiwebpack-cli-DcnpmupdatenpmWARNdeprecatedextract-text-webpack-plugin@3.0.2:Deprecated.Plea…
前提已安装node(版本号>4.0,已自带NPM)mac机器有一个空目录无webpack.config.js配置打包快速构建package.json文件。npminit-y安装webpack4及其命令行接口npmiwebpackweb…
前言为什么要使用构建工具?1.转换ES6语法(很多老版本的浏览器不支持新语法)2.转换JSX3.CSS前缀补全/预处理器4.压缩混淆(将代码逻辑尽可能地隐藏起来)5.图片压缩6.....为什么选择webpack?社区生态丰富配置灵活、插件化…
据说webpack3比webpack4编译速度将近快了60%-80%,成功升级之后,于是来记录下,项目主要是vue^2.5.9,webpack^4.10.2,webpack-dev-sever^3.1.4,配合升级的还有vue-loader…
问题postcss.config.js是公用的配置,postcss-loader官网示例,只要你配置了postcss-loader,它就会默认加载项目根目录下的postcss.config.js文件,所以如果postcss.config.j…
本文记录webpack的一些常用高级概念,需要对webapck基础有所了解,本文重点记录概念涉及到的配置,其他配置有所省略,更多内容参照官方文档。webpack中文网webpack英文网TreeShaking作用是当引入一个模块时,不会引入…
webpack-dev-server的3.1.0版本只支持webpack4,所以以前的版本都不能使用3.1.0版本。而webpack4把webpack-cli分离开来,所以要单独安装。而webpack4较之前的版本运行更快。在官网给出的示例…
webpack的核心价值就是前端源码的打包,即将前端源码中每一个文件(无论任何类型)都当做一个pack,然后分析依赖,将其最终打包出线上运行的代码。webpack的四个核心部分entry规定入口文件,一个或者多个output规定输出文件的位…
webpack在单页面打包上应用广泛,以create-react-app为首的脚手架众多,单页面打包通常是将业务js,css打包到同一个html文件中,整个项目只有一个html文件入口,但也有许多业务需要多个页面不同的入口,比如不同的h5活…
demo目录:1.将css打包到js内部配置文件./conf/webpack.dev.js:constpath=require("path");module.exports={mode:"development",//打包为开发模式entr…
Webpack的CommonsChunkPlugin插件,负责将多次被使用的JS模块打包在一起。CommonsChunkPlugin能解决的问题在使用插件前,考虑几个问题:对哪些chunk进行提取,这决定了chunks,children和n…
前面的话本文将详细介绍从webpack3到webpack4的升级过程概述相比于webpack3,webpack4可以零配置运行,打包速度比之前提高了90%,可以直接到ES6的代码进行无用代码剔除,新增的optimization使用简单在未来…
阅读前为什么使用服务器渲染??官方解释应该对VueSSR指南简单了解?官方文档应该对webpack简单了解?官方文档Node.js框架Koa简单了解?官方文档正文构建服务器端渲染(SSR)我们可以利用vue-server-renderer插…